    $\begingroup$ @Tim The most common situation on this site where somebody asks for an alternative test for large sample sizes occurs when they have discovered the test they are using achieves astronomically small p-values, perhaps for small effect sizes, and they are hoping to find some less powerful alternative! These questions arise from several basic misunderstandings of what tests are for and how to interpret them. That is why it is useful to ascertain the motivation behind the question before making assumptions (or, worse, actually answering the question). $\endgroup$

Are you testing for the independence between variables? If so, except for the chi-square test, we may try (apart from log-linear, which is also suggested):

$\bullet$ Cochran–Mantel–Haenszel test: repeated tests of independence for nominal variables.

$\bullet$ Fisher's Exact Test: this test may give you more precise estimate for independence if the expected number is not large.
